In this special episode of I’m Still Here, Heather sits down with her son Ty to talk openly about his adoption journey, growing up as a brown child in a rural community, and what it’s been like navigating identity, belonging, and difference.
Ty shares his story of being adopted from India, what family means when you don’t share DNA, and the moments that shaped how he sees himself and the world. Together, they talk about racism, being pulled over, finding confidence, developing empathy, and how music became Ty’s way of expressing his life experiences.
This is an honest, real conversation about growing up different, learning to be comfortable in your own skin, and finding your people — even when it isn’t easy.

🎧 About the Podcast:
I’m Still Here: Lessons from Life with Metastatic Breast Cancer is hosted by Heather and Larry Jose. Each week, they share honest, hopeful conversations about living fully with cancer — the messy, meaningful, real-life parts of survivorship that don’t always make it into the brochure.
